Bill Bell always had characters on his shows named after his real life children. William (Bill), Bradley (Brad) Lauralee

Y&R: Brad Elliott

Brad Carlton

William (Bill) Foster Sr. and Jr.

William (Billy) Abbott.

Lauralee (Lorie) Brooks

Lauren Fenmore (which I assume Lauren was a play on Lauralee's name)

B&B William Spencer (Bill) Sr. & Jr.

Margaret Depriest did do serial killer stories, but only on two of the soaps she head-wrote for.

DAYS: I'm not sure if she did the strangler, but she did do the slasher story which involved the murder of a popular anti-heroine.

AW: Sin Stalker (led to the murder of a popular character Quinn, which caused a surprise backlash) and then again in the mid 90s (led to the death of Frankie.. only after original choice Donna was saved by a spoiler leak and fan outrage caused them to shift gears).

However, other then that... I think Depriest was known more for keeping the ball rolling as opposed to getting the ball rolling (her 70s stints on LOL and The Doctors support that).. so having her come in to write for AW both times when the show was struggling never made sense.. nor did her head-writing Sunset Beach make much sense either.

Bill Bell also did stories were a character accidentally fell in love with a sibling.

Days: Marie & Tommy

Y&R: Lorie & Mark Henderson, Victoria Newman & Cole Howard (later turned out to be not true).
